What changed in OSHA’s updated warehouse & distribution center NEP

August 7, 2026 · OSHA’s revised Warehousing and Distribution Center National Emphasis Program, effective July 31, clarified expansions, removed retail, and made ergonomics & heat documentation optional.

OSHA fines H-E-B nearly $18K for warehouse forklift fatality

June 5, 2026 · OSHA fined grocery chain H-E-B nearly $18K for not evaluating forklift operators and unsafe walking surfaces after Teresa Dominguez was killed in a Texas cold storage warehouse.
